**Vendor note: Inkmill markdown pipeline**

Rendering for Parchway docs is outsourced to Inkmill under an annual contract, renewing each March. They handle sanitization and PDF export; we own the upload queue. SLA: 4-hour response on rendering failures. Escalate only after two failed retries. Their support desk is reachable at the address below.

billing contact of hahaf-baguf = zorael.tammir.jorius@sivrelhq.internal

Subject: Q3 stock-count ledger — courier today

Dispatch,

The Q3 stock-count ledger for the Brindlemoor depot goes out this afternoon. Single sealed envelope, marked FINANCE ONLY. Auditors at Cravenholt need it before Friday's close, so no batching with routine mail. Log it as priority, not standard. Courier must follow the hand-over instruction noted directly below this message.

drop instructions, yafog-yawip: the quenmir olidor courier leaves the julox tamion keliel ledger at gate 5283 under passcode 336825

## Zero-Downtime Schema Migrations — Limits (Ostermill Platform)

Reviewers: every migration on the Ostermill Platform must be expand/backfill/contract, and each phase runs under the limits below. Reject any change that locks a table longer than the lock budget or batches rows above the cap — our replicas in the Harbrook region lag badly past those thresholds. Backfills pause automatically when replication lag exceeds the ceiling, then resume. Contract steps ship at least one release after expand. The enforced limits are as follows.

tuning table, yajog-yahof:
BUDGETS = {
    "lamvan": 303,
    "wenox": 460,
    "fenvan": 525,
}

FAQ — Shuttle-Bus Gate (Night Shift)

Q: How do I open the shuttle-bus gate after hours?
A: The gate at the north end of the Calverton site is unmanned between 21:00 and 05:30. Drivers should stop fully on the induction loop first; if the gate does not lift within ten seconds, use the keypad on the left pillar. Enter the code below.

door code, yagap-bahof: bdg-O-05

## Dedup pipeline access

The Mergewell dedup job matches customer records nightly against the internal Canonix identity store. You need read/write scope; read-only will fail at the merge step. Run it from the batch cluster only — laptops are blocked. Config lives in dedup.yaml; set the endpoint to the staging Canonix host until your first review passes. Put the following key in the auth field.

gateway credential: kto3_qfe